Over the next several decades, more than 150 million Americans will experience decreased quality of life due to climate shifts — mostly increased temperatures and decreased access to clean water. A great many of them will pick up and move. 250k Americans have already moved.
Experts estimate somewhere between 10 million and 60 million Americans will either choose or be forced to move in the coming decades.
That’s an order of magnitude larger than the continent’s previously largest shift — The Great Migration — when six million African Americans left the south and moved to the north, west, and midwest. That shift redefined the country.
The biggest population losers are likely to be Texas, Florida, and Louisiana, while the northeast benefits the most.
